

Jerald (Jerry) Daily died unexpectedly but peacefully in his sleep on 5 August 2014. He was born 17 January 1941 in Grand Rapids, Michigan where he lived until graduating Lee High School in 1959. After a four month courtship he married Georgia (King) also of Grand Rapids in February1964 and the newlyweds immediately moved to Los Angeles, California to pursue Jerry’s dream of becoming a teacher. Jerry received his BA and MA from California State University at Northridge and began his teaching career at Mt. Vernon Jr. High in Los Angeles, California. He later taught at Parkman Jr. High School in Woodland Hills, California and finished his thirty-three year teaching career at Taft High School in Woodland Hills in 2001. Jerry passed his passion for history and government onto his students and followed politics and world events closely outside the classroom. Jerry was actively involved in his church where he shared his talent for teaching and educating by leading Sunday school classes and Bible study groups. He is survived by his wife, Georgia; sons Stephen (Bangkok, Thailand) and David (Canoga Park, CA); sisters Dona (Tarzana, CA) and Lynda (Boston, MA); and loving nieces, nephews and in-laws across the country.
